Beiler's Bakery has only two inspections on file, a thin record to work from. The newest entry in the record is dated Feb 18, 2025. When a facility lands in medium risk territory, it usually means a mixed inspection result.

Violation counts have been trending down, averaging around six violations across recent inspections versus roughly eight violations before.

The pattern that stands out is “food properly labeled”, which has been cited two times.

Beiler's Bakery scores about where you'd expect for a Philadelphia restaurant. On the whole, the file is mixed but not concerning.

Inspection History
Feb 18, 2025
Reinspection
6 minor violations.
View 6 violations
Food properly labeled; original container
Inspector notes: Prepackaged food (cakes, pies, cookies, and pastries) is not labeled properly with the name of product, ingredient statement, net weight, distributed by statement and/or nutritional facts.
46.422
Contamination prevented during food preparation, storage & display
Inspector notes: Bulk food items are not stored at least 6 inches above the floor and inside the walk-in cooler.
46.321
Food & non-food contact surfaces cleanable, properly designed, constructed, & used
Inspector notes: An air curtain is missing from the customer reach-in refrigerator.
46.671
Non-food contact surfaces clean
Inspector notes: Dust and debris observed on the interior walk-in cooler surfaces and racks. Dust and debris observed on lower shelf surfaces in the prep and storage areas.
46.714
Physical facilities installed, maintained, & clean
Inspector notes: Dust and debris observed on the floor perimeters of the prep, storage, and 2nd level storage areas. Dust and debris observed on wall and ceiling surfaces in the prep and storage areas.
46.981(a)(b)(c)(g)(n)
Adequate ventilation & lighting; designated areas used
Inspector notes: A coat observed on shelving with food items in the storage area. Management must designate space for employee clothing. New Violation.
46.981(j)

Jan 7, 2025
Routine
8 minor violations.
View 8 violations
Food properly labeled; original container
Inspector notes: Prepackaged food (cakes, pies, cookies, and pastries) is not labeled properly with the name of product, ingredient statement, net weight, distributed by statement and/or nutritional facts. New Violation.
46.422
Insects, rodents & animals not present; no unauthorized persons
Inspector notes: Mouse feces observed on the floor perimeters and the lower shelves at the front service, rear storage, stairs, and 2nd level storage areas. New Violation.
46.981(k)(l)
Contamination prevented during food preparation, storage & display
Inspector notes: Food is not stored at least 6 inches above the floor inside the walk-in cooler. New Violation.
46.321
Wiping cloths: properly used & stored
Inspector notes: Moist wiping cloths observed lying on counters and not stored in sanitizing solution. New Violation.
46.304
Food & non-food contact surfaces cleanable, properly designed, constructed, & used
Inspector notes: An air curtain is missing from the customer reach-in refrigerator. A milk crate is used for item storage, instead of approved shelving. New Violation.
46.671
Warewashing facilities: installed, maintained, & used; test strips
Inspector notes: Food facility lacks quaternary sanitizer test strips to monitor sanitizer concentration. New Violation.
46.634
Non-food contact surfaces clean
Inspector notes: Dust and debris observed on the interior walk-in cooler surfaces and racks. Dust, debris, and mouse feces observed on lower shelf surfaces in the prep and storage areas. New Violation.
46.714
Physical facilities installed, maintained, & clean
Inspector notes: Dust, debris, and mouse feces observed on the floor perimeters of the prep, storage, and 2nd level storage areas. Dust and debris observed on wall surfaces in the prep areas. New Violation.
46.981(a)(b)(c)(g)(n)
